'A vous' is the formal way of saying 'to you.' In French, there are two ways to address someone in the second person. 'Vous' is the formal way and 'toi' is the informal. So if you're speaking to your friend or younger sibling, you would use 'toi' whereas if you're speaking with a professor, a stranger, or your boss, you'd want to use 'vous.'
